How do I care for and store my Barbie doll collection?

Caring for and storing Barbie dolls requires attention to detail to maintain their condition. It’s recommended to keep them away from direct sunlight, moisture, and extreme temperatures. Dolls should be stored in a cool, dry place, preferably in their original packaging or a protective case to prevent damage. Handling the dolls with care, avoiding touching the facial area and hair, can also help preserve their condition.

How can I determine the value of my Barbie doll collection?

Determining the value of a Barbie doll collection involves considering several factors, including the rarity of the dolls, their condition, and demand. Researching similar dolls that have been sold, either through online marketplaces or specialized collector communities, can provide an estimate of their value. Additionally, consulting with a professional appraiser or a seasoned collector can offer more precise valuations, especially for rare or vintage dolls.
